摘 要:实验教学正面临着一场深刻的变革。依托虚拟仿真技术开展实验教学已成为高校推进实验教学改革、优化实验教学资源结构、提升实验教学资源使用效益的必然要求。采用虚拟仿真实验教学模式可在很大程度上解决传统实验教学成本高、风险大、时间固定、内容单一、运行呆板等问题。本文从实验教学的客观需求入手,以无人机航空摄影测量实习为例,总结了当前实验教学模式中存在的问题,分析了虚拟仿真技术在实验教学的特点和优势,以及虚拟仿真实验课程构建中应注意的问题。最后指出必须不断实践、完善和探索,才能持续提升虚拟仿真实验教学水平。The ex per iment teaching is f acing a profound change.Vir tua l simulation technolog y has become an inevitable requirement for universities to promote experimental teaching reform,optimize the structure of experimental teaching resources and improve the eff iciency of the use of experimental teaching resources.Virtual simulation experiment teaching pattern can,to some extent,solve problems in traditional experiment teaching pattern,such as high cost,high risk,inf lexible time,single content and monotony.This paper,starting with the demands of experimental teaching,takes the photogrammetry practice as an example,summarizes the existing problems in the current experimental teaching pattern,analyzes the characteristics and advantages of the virtual simulation technology in the experimental teaching,and the problems that should be paid attention to in the construction of virtual simulation experiment course.Finally,it is pointed out that we must constantly practice,improve and explore in order to continuously improve the level of virtual simulation experiment teaching.
